Comfort Source

What is your comfort source?.. 


We have all sorts of things in our lives that provide comfort when we seek them and use them properly. 


From comfortable shoes, clothes, and chairs, to people, places, and things, when we find comfort, we tend to return to the source of it again and again. 


Our relationship with God works the same way when we seek Him. 


He is waiting to help us.


All we have to do is grow our relationship with Him and allow His Holy Spirit to become our source of comfort. 


So…what is your source of comfort?.. 


Check your experience…. 


“We could wish to be moral, we could wish to be philosophically comforted, in fact, we could will these things with all our might, but the needed power wasn’t there.” Big Book pg. 45


 Lord, let us seek and find comfort in You, AMEN. 


 “All praise to God, the Father of our Lord Jesus Christ. God is our merciful Father and the source of all comfort. He comforts us in all our troubles so that we can comfort others. When they are troubled, we will be able to give them the same comfort God has given us.” 2 Corinthians 1:3-4
